dc.description.abstractThe article challenges the missional church movement to enter into dialogue with the business community on leadership issues. It illustrates how the work of Otto Scharmer helps faith communities to understand discernment. It assumes a new theological epistemology and accepts the movement away from foundationalism. It illustrates how discernment should take place in a new reality with new interdisciplinary dialogue partners.en_ZA
